Why Shared Spaces Require Advanced Disinfection

High-traffic environments contain frequently touched surfaces that can contribute to cross-contamination and pathogen transmission. Door handles, desks, elevator buttons, counters, shared devices, seating areas, and medical equipment can all harbor microorganisms if not disinfected consistently.

Understanding LED UVC Technology

LED UVC technology uses germicidal ultraviolet light to deactivate bacteria, viruses, and fungi by disrupting their DNA and RNA structures. This process helps prevent microorganisms from reproducing and spreading on surfaces.
